Former White Plains Mayor Adam Bradley's retrial on attempted assault and harassment charges stemming from a fight with his ex-wife will be held in April, a White Plains judge said Thursday.
Bradley appeared in State Supreme Court on Thursday morning, where Judge Richard Molea set April 8 as the new trial date. Westchester County District Attorney Janet DiFiore is retrying the former mayor...
